水晶砖编程通常指的是使用水晶砖(Crystal Tiles)进行编程教育的方式。水晶砖是一种用于教授编程概念的物理工具,可以帮助初学者理解编程的基本原理和概念。
水晶砖编程的基本原理
水晶砖编程的基本原理是通过操纵物理水晶砖的排列来模拟编程语句和算法的执行过程。每个水晶砖代表一个特定的指令或操作,通过将这些砖块组合在一起,学生可以理解代码的执行流程和逻辑。
水晶砖编程的优势
相比于纯软件编程,水晶砖编程具有以下优势:
- 直观理解: 初学者可以通过物理砖块的排列更直观地理解编程概念和算法原理,降低学习难度。
- 亲身操作: 学生可以通过动手操纵水晶砖,参与到编程过程中,增强学习的互动性和趣味性。
- 理论联系实际: 水晶砖编程可以帮助学生将抽象的编程概念与实际的物理操作相结合,加深对编程原理的理解。
水晶砖编程的实践应用
水晶砖编程广泛应用于学校和编程教育机构,用于教授基础的编程概念和算法逻辑。通过水晶砖编程,学生可以在趣味性和实践性中,逐步建立起对编程思维的认知,为将来的软件编程打下良好的基础。
水晶砖编程的指导建议
如果你有兴趣尝试水晶砖编程教育,以下是一些建议:
水晶砖编程是一种有趣且实用的教育方法,适合初学者快速理解编程概念和逻辑,同时培养动手能力和创造力。
版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。